The birth year of Italian field hockey can be traced back to 1935: under the impetus of the upcoming Berlin Olympics. In the ‘50, the arrival of foreign technicians favored an increase in the technical level, which led the nation- al team to participate in the Olympic Games of 1952 and 1960. Previously within the “Italian Hockey and Skating Federation”, CONI recognized it as a “member” on 29 September 1973 as the Italian Field Hockey Federation (FIHSP); it became effective on 18 January 1978. From 18 November 1984, it took the name of the Italian Hockey Federation.The Italian Field Hockey Championship is the main sporting event for Italian field hockey clubs. It consists of three levels. The first 2 are at the national level, while the other one is at the regional level. The Italian Hockey Federation organ- izes and directs Serie A1, Serie A2 and Serie B. The overall staff of the two top leagues consists of a total of 26 clubs.
